Gao, David Yang Nonlinear elastic beam theory with application in contact problems and variational approaches. (English) Zbl 0843.73042 Mech. Res. Commun. 23, No. 1, 11-17 (1996). By considering the stress in lateral direction, a nonlinear beam theory is developed for large displacement and small strain. Application to the unilateral problem with obstacle is illustrated, and a nonlinear complementarity problem is proposed. We prove that this nonlinear complementarity problem is equivalent to a variational inequality.
